This is 2 days overdue, the 3rd launch anniversary passed on February 15th, however I didn't think it was worth making any sort of post considering not many users were able to access due to the on-going DoS attack.

I would bet on this not being the end of it, but I'll take the opportunity now to discuss what we have been doing behind the scenes and share it to /r/DreadAlert (over on Reddit) to continue the discussion if and when it does continue.

Both myself and /u/Paris are completely burned out from the hours we've had to put into this attack, its the largest any attacker has scaled up with us, we scaled much much further and seriously hurt the whole Tor network, but we did hit a bottle neck in this approach and no matter how much we scaled there would have been no possibility of much uptime. We did have it stabilized mostly today, however had issues with some crashes which we will resolve going forward. These attacks just make us a lot stronger and we learn more about the effects and solutions every time. With that being said, there is no easy way to avoid them, who'd have thought, two years down the line, we still wouldn't have any sort of fix. We are in a dire situation of need for a PoW implementation at the intro points if we want to stand a chance without shovelling piles of cash into the furnace.
